begin process at 2012 05 29 13:18:57
  Trouver un code source :
 
dans
 
Accueil > Forum > 

C++ & C++ .NET

 > 

Divers

 > 

Divers

 > 

Mettre une adresse dans un pointeur


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

Mettre une adresse dans un pointeur

mercredi 27 décembre 2006 à 20:51:38 | Mettre une adresse dans un pointeur

pepsidrinker


Bonjour!
vous trouverez sans doute ma question stupide,
mais jaimerai avoirun moyen pour mettre une adresse voulus
dans un pointeur.
exemple :
long* a;
a = 0x00ff.....
bon....seulement, le compilateur ne veut pas me laisser faire,probleme de compatiubilité
de type.
0x00ff....n'Est pas du type long*....comment faire svp?
Pepsidrinker
mercredi 27 décembre 2006 à 21:19:18 | Re : Mettre une adresse dans un pointeur

luhtor

long * a = (long*)(0x00FF...)
mercredi 27 décembre 2006 à 21:46:55 | Re : Mettre une adresse dans un pointeur

pepsidrinker

Sa marche mais sa ne marche pas...
en fait,voici ce que je veut faire:

un app démarre, cré une variable.
elle execute une 2ieme app et lui envois comme parametre ladresse de la variable qu'elle vient de créé.

la 2ieme app veut savoir la valeur de cette variable,dont elle vient de recevoir ladresse en parametre...

ta syntaxe est bonne, mais a léxecution....sa faille.






Pepsidrinker
jeudi 28 décembre 2006 à 01:12:04 | Re : Mettre une adresse dans un pointeur

luhtor

Oula, je te conseigne d'aller voir la doc du langage C. Je sens que tu nages la ... Chapitre les pointeurs.


samedi 6 janvier 2007 à 15:28:37 | Re : Mettre une adresse dans un pointeur

Niels Abel

Bien sur que ca ne marche pas parce que l'adressee 0x00FF... dans ta 1ère app n'est pas la même que la 0x00FF... dans la 2ème! Pourquoi? Parce que le système gère la mémoire en utilisant des mémoires virtuelles, autrement dit : 0x00FF... ne correspond pas à cette même adresse physique (réelle). Chaque pocessus a donc, hélas, son propre 0x00FF...
samedi 6 janvier 2007 à 16:01:51 | Re : Mettre une adresse dans un pointeur

pepsidrinker

Merci bcp de l'info !

Maintenant....y a til un moyen de convertir add.virtuelle en add.réelle et vice versa......ou sinon kkun connaitrai i-til un moyen de transmettre un pointeur dans 2 app différente comme dans mon exemple?



Pepsidrinker



Cette discussion est classée dans : long, type, adresse, pointeur, 0x00ff


Répondre à ce message

Sujets en rapport avec ce message

type de variable? long int ? [ par dleewax ] salut! je suis nouveau dans le C++ et j'ai un petit problème... je suis en train de faire un petit programme permettant de calculer les factorielles.. tableau de structures type pointeur [ par chocho ] Voila, je fait en c unpetit utilitaire de gestion d'adhérents.pour cela j'uilise un tableau de structure adhérent composée de deux pointeurs char *nom conversion en unsigned long [ par flatou ] voila j'ai un type de donnée défini comme suit :typedef unsigned long long my_ulonglong;#endifc'est un type de donnée MySQL. Or j'ai vu que pour utili Donner une adresse à un pointeur... [ par anosan ] Salut,J'aimerais savoir comment spécifier à un pointeur quelle adresse il doit pointer (sachant que cette adresse n'est pas celle d'une variable!).Mer Mémoire partagée et pointeur [ par darsh99 ] Bonjour,J'essai de faire passer un tableau dynamique, un pointeur donc, d'un programme à un autre, l'adresse est bien passée et les champs non dynamiq PROB avec pointeur THIS [ par jfk20004 ] Salut,tout ce que je sais à propos du pointeur this:-c'est un pointeur sur l'adresse d'un objet-il permet des appels en cascade de fonctionsquelqu'un retrouver le type d'un pointeur de fenêtre(menu,bouton?) [ par hdaniel ] Bonjour,J'ai un pointeur de fenêtre (et son handle).je désire savoir si c'est une toolbar.comment fait-onhdaniel adresse de fichier [ par cobra176 ] je recherche le moyens d'accées a un fichier texte qui peut se trouver dansun dossiermon code est:char adresseprintf("choisir le type et le format du "Comparaison" pointeur [ par LordBob ] Bonjour a tous,voila j'ai des petits problèmes avec une application et mes pointeurs... en fait je récupéren en début de programme l'adresse IP d'une pb de type de variable [ par mimie_istase ] Salut à tous, Je travaille en C++ sur un programme de corrélation d'images je dois donc manipuler des antiers très grands. Le problème c'est que j'ai


Nos sponsors


Sondage...

CalendriCode

Mai 2012
LMMJVSD
 123456
78910111213
14151617181920
21222324252627
28293031   

Consulter la suite du CalendriCode

Photothèque

A découvrir



 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,328 sec (3)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ales